18th Century Carved Wood Drapery Headboard-
About the Item
with faux marble carved wood gentle scroll
surmounted by carved wood parcel gilt tassels
the drapery panels having pulled effect
with tied corners draping down to
parcel gilt carved wood bouillon fringe
the exterior faux fabric in dark crimson gilt
the interior with antiqued down tone fuschia
the color and detail unparalleled in this piece of history.
- Dimensions:Height: 61 in (154.94 cm)Width: 67 in (170.18 cm)Depth: 16.5 in (41.91 cm)

- 18th Century Italian Walnut Wood Pulpit CanopyLocated in Dallas, TXThis large and attractive architectural piece is known as a pulpit canopy. Before the advent of microphones and speakers, orators would often address assemblies from elevated platforms known as “wine glass pulpits”. These podiums featured domed roofs called abat-voix, sometimes known as sounding boards, that would project sound outwards. Our walnut wood pulpit canopy is a fine example of such a device. Hand-carved and hand-painted in Italy in the 1700’s, our abat-voix is roughly octagonal in shape. Each of the sides have edges with luxuriously thick step molding, alternating between stained and gilded wood. Each of the corner cornices are adorned with gilded flower carvings, although some are missing. The interior of the canopy features a gilded open sun with sinuous rays emanating all around. Each of the sides are adorned with foliate margents surrounded by scrolls, again with some losses. All the edges are bordered with a thin layer of gilding.
